How does it work?
The Workplace Culture domain includes areas such as leadership, contribution, engagement, recognition and wellbeing. Respondents answer a set of statements by indicating their level of agreement, from strongly disagree to strongly agree. Responses are anonymous, which is essential for both the integrity of the data and the security of respondents. Some examples include:
- Our company values are effectively communicated and reinforced
- Teams collaborate well across departments or functions
- I receive acknowledgment for my contributions and achievements
- My current priorities and focus areas are well defined
- Our clients receive outstanding service and support
- I maintain a healthy balance between professional and personal commitments
Collecting this data consistently over time helps identify patterns and provides insight and context around key periods of change or growth. For example, you might notice that recognition scores dip after a period of organisational change. This insight can give leaders something concrete to work with, whether it is adjusting how feedback is delivered, redistributing workload, or having more informed conversations with their teams.
